암호화 및 해독 개선을 위한 반복적 방법

이 논문은 소프트 입력 해독(SID) 방법을 통해 암호화 체크 값의 오류를 수정하는 기술에 대해 설명한다. SID는 SISO 볼루션 채널 디코딩과 암호화 해독을 결합하여 오류를 수정하고, 이를 통해 해독 성능을 향상시킨다.

저자: Natasa Zivic, (University of Siegen, Germany)

이 논문은 암호화 체크 값의 오류 수정을 위한 소프트 입력 해독(SID) 방법과 이를 확장한 반복 SID에 대해 설명한다.SID는 SISO 볼루션 채널 디코딩과 암호화 해독을 결합하여, 특히 노이지 환경에서의 오류 수정 능력을 향상시킨다. 암호화 체크 값은 디지털 서명, MAC 및 H-MAC 등으로 구현되며, 이들 모두가 실용적으로 사용되고 있다.SID는 채널 디코더의 소프트 출력(L-값)을 사용해 암호화 메커니즘의 입력 오류를 수정한다. L-값은 복구된 비트가 잘못되었을 확률을 나타내며, 이를 통해 가장 가능성이 높은 오류 위치를 식별하고 수정할 수 있다. SID 방법은 두 가지 주요 전략으로 구현된다: 직렬 및 병렬 반복 SID. 직렬 방식에서는 각 단계가 순차적으로 수행되지만, 병렬 방식에서는 두 개의 블록이 동시에 처리되어 더 효율적인 오류 수정을 가능하게 한다. 실험 결과는 병렬SID가 직렬SID보다 향상된 성능을 보여주며, 특히 복잡한 통신 환경에서 더욱 효과적임을 입증한다. 실험은 320비트 길이의 SID 블록을 사용하며, AWGN 채널을 통해 전송된다. 구현된 볼루션 인코더는 코드율 1/2와 제약 길이 2를 가지며, 디코더는 MAP 알고리즘을 사용한다. 실험은 C/C++ 프로그래밍 언어로 수행되며, 각 곡선의 점마다 50,000번의 테스트가 수행된다. 실험 결과는 SID 방법이 오류 수정 성능을 크게 향상시키며, 특히 병렬SID 전략은 직렬SID보다 더 높은 코딩 이득을 제공함을 보여준다. 이 논문은SID 및 반복SID의 기술적 세부 사항과 실험 결과를 통해 통신 시스템에서 암호화와 채널 코딩 간의 협력을 강조한다.

원본 논문

고화질 논문을 불러오는 중입니다...

댓글 및 학술 토론

Loading comments...

의견 남기기